repledging

/riˈplɛdʒɪŋ/
verb
  1. Present participle of repledge; the act of pledging again or renewing a promise or commitment.
    • Repledging their support, the volunteers signed up for another year.
    • By repledging their donations, the sponsors ensured the festival would continue.
    • The senator is repledging to fight for healthcare reform.
